Recent WWE and TNA television ratings figures

Television ratings figures courtesy of The Wrestling Observer Newsletter.

WWE Smackdown: The 9/16 show drew a 1.80 cable rating with 2.61 million viewers. It ended up as the fourth highest rated show on cable that night.

TNA Impact Wrestling: The 9/15 show drew a 1.20 cable rating with 1.65 million viewers. It ended up at the No. 10 spot for the night on cable. The Sting vs. Ric Flair main event drew a strong 1.4 rating. The show drew a 0.90 among males 18-34 and 1.10 among males 35-49.

Hulk Hogan’s Micro Championship Wrestling: The 9/14 debut show on TruTV drew a 0.81 cable rating with 999,000 viewers.

WWE Monday Night Raw: The 9/12 show drew a 2.72 cable rating with 3.9 million viewers. The first hour drew a 2.72 rating (3.82 million viewers), while the second hour drew a 2.71 (3.89 million viewers). This ended up as the lowest rated regular or non-holiday episode of Raw in almost 14 years going back to December 15, 1997. It went up against two double-header “Monday Night Football” games on ESPN that dominated cable on Monday night.
